Table 2: Socio-demographic characteristics, Interventions and Caregivers Inheritance perception of children who sucked their fingers.
Variables | Frequency | Percentage (%) |
Gender of the child (n = 37) | ||
Male | 24 | 64.9 |
Female | 13 | 35.1 |
Birth order (n = 33) | ||
1 | 16 | 48.5 |
2 | 11 | 33.3 |
3 | 4 | 12.1 |
4 | 2 | 6.1 |
Age at commencement of digital sucking (n = 40) | ||
1 month | 17 | 42.5 |
2-3 months | 12 | 30 |
3-4 months | 11 | 27.5 |
Interventions (n = 46) | ||
Wrapping of finger | 8 | 17.4 |
Manual removal | 14 | 30.4 |
Application of bitter substance | 6 | 13.1 |
Verbal reprimand | 4 | 8.7 |
Nothing | 11 | 23.9 |
Physical punishment | 3 | 6.5 |
Effectiveness in intervention (n = 29) | ||
Yes | 15 | 51.7 |
No | 14 | 48.3 |
Caregivers inheritance perception (n = 45) | ||
Index parent sucked | ||
Yes | 5 | 11.1 |
No | 27 | 60 |
Don't know | 13 | 28.9 |
Other parent sucked | ||
Yes | 5 | 11.1 |
No | 22 | 48.9 |
Don't know | 18 | 40 |
Runs in family | ||
Yes | 4 | 8.9 |
No | 26 | 57.8 |
Don't know | 15 | 33.3 |
